Date Posted: 20:26:06 04/03/13 Wed The Commission on Population re-aligns its program to the whims and caprices of the current president. The past President GMA focussed more on the natural FP while Pnoy emphasizes on the promotion of responsible parenthood and FP. Pnoy's thrust aims to provide info and services on all FP methods which should be readily available, accessible, and appropriate. Public health and responsible parenthood form a part of pnoy's commitment to the Philippine society that would manifest good governance. Popcom has had been implementing RP programs and went further to expand its program covering FP methods (both natural and artificial) in 2011. From Jan - Dec. 2011, here are some milestones that Popcom had accomplished: *292,015 couples were oriented on RP-FP through the conduct of baranggay classes in areas identified by DSWD's Pantawid Pamilya program, and this includes the food-poor areas in the country. * Baranggay Service Point Officers (BSPO's) , a brain-child of Popcom, took active participation by way of contributing to the Universal Health Care program of DOH Community Health Teams, working under the umbrella of the Aquino Health Agenda.
